To celebrate AAPI Heritage Month, the newly formed UCSF Asian American Pacific Islanders Coalition (AAPIC) presents "Status of APA at UCSF" to inform our community on the current status of Asian Pacific Islanders from a global to national perspectives and also within our Bay Area and UCSF community. In addition to the presentation, we are bringing a panel representing different API groups at UCSF to speak about the work they do.
Current panelists include:
- Jeff Chiu, Vice President of Human Resources for UCSF Health, including UCSF Benioff Children's Hospital.
- Hanmin Lee, MD, Director of the UCSF Fetal Treatment Center and Surgeon-In-Chief of UCSF Benioff Children's Hospital.
